Ingredients:

  • 5 lbs Kirby or pickling cucumbers
  • 3 tbsp coarse sea salt
  • 10 cloves garlic, smashed
  • 4 cups distilled white vinegar
  • 4 cups filtered water
  • 1/3 cup sea salt
  • 2 tbsp whole black peppercorns
  • 1 tbsp dill seeds
  • 1 tsp sugar
  • 10 sprigs fresh dill
  • 10 slices fresh lemon

Instructions:

  1. Wash cucumbers and slice off 1/16th of an inch from the blossom end of each cucumber to remove enzymes that cause softening.
  2. Leave cucumbers whole or slice into spears.
  3. Toss cucumbers with 3 tbsp of sea salt in a large bowl and let sit for 2 hours to draw out moisture, then rinse thoroughly with cold water.
  4. In a stainless steel pot, combine distilled white vinegar, filtered water, 1/3 cup sea salt, sugar, peppercorns, and dill seeds.
  5. Bring the brine to a rolling boil over high heat, then reduce heat and simmer for 5 minutes.
  6. Place one smashed garlic clove and one sprig of fresh dill at the bottom of each of the 10 pint jars.
  7. Pack the cucumbers tightly into the jars so they do not float.
  8. Tuck one lemon slice into the side of each jar and pour the hot brine over the cucumbers, filling to the top.
  9. Seal jars and refrigerate for 48 hours to allow flavors to penetrate for peak crunch and taste.
